Jannik Sinner vs Jakub Mensik live streaming, TV channel, where & how to watch: ATP Qatar Open 2026

Sinner faces Mensik for the first time on the ATP tour.
Jannik Sinner and Jakub Mensik are set for a compelling quarter-final clash at the Qatar Open, with both players arriving in strong form and confidence. The matchup pits one of the tour’s most consistent elite performers against one of its fastest-rising young power hitters.
Sinner has looked supremely composed so far in Doha, extending his momentum with straight sets win over Alexei Popyrin. The Italian is yet to face a single break point across two rounds, showcasing his dominance on serve.
Mensik, meanwhile, continues to build on a breakout start to the season. The 20-year-old Czech has not lost a completed match in 2026, highlighted by his title run at the ASB Classic and a confident performance against Zhang Zhizhen in Doha.
This quarter-final will mark the first tour-level meeting between the two, adding an extra layer of intrigue. With semi-final stakes on the line, the contest shapes up to be an exciting one.
When and where will Jannik Sinner vs Jakub Mensik, quarter-final match at ATP Qatar Open 2026, take place?
The quarter-final face-off between Sinner and Mensik is set to take place on February 19 (Thursday). The venue is the Khalifa International Tennis and Squash Complex in Doha. The match has a tentative start time of 8:40 pm local time and 11:10 pm in India.
